全国性编程比赛是什么意思啊

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    全国性编程比赛是一种面向全国范围内编程爱好者的比赛活动。这类比赛通常由相关编程组织或机构组织,旨在为广大编程爱好者提供一个展示自己技术能力、交流学习经验的平台。

    这类比赛一般会设立多个参赛组别,包括初级组、中级组和高级组等,以满足不同程度的编程水平。比赛内容通常涵盖各种编程语言和技术领域,例如算法设计、数据结构、网络编程、人工智能等。参赛选手需要在规定的时间内完成一系列编程任务或解答编程题目,评委会根据参赛选手的程序正确性、效率和创新性等方面进行评判。

    全国性编程比赛具有一定的专业性和竞争性,不仅能够检验参赛选手的编程技能和解决问题的能力,还能够促进编程爱好者之间的交流和学习。此外,一些优秀的参赛选手还有机会获得奖项和荣誉,甚至得到一些公司或组织的关注和招聘机会。

    参加全国性编程比赛对于编程爱好者来说,不仅可以提升自己的技术水平,还能够扩展自己的人脉圈和职业发展机会。因此,这类比赛在编程界具有很高的影响力和参与度。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    全国性编程比赛是指在全国范围内举行的面向编程技能的比赛活动。这类比赛通常面向学生、职业程序员或编程爱好者,旨在提升参赛者的编程能力、培养团队合作精神、激发创新思维,并为参赛者提供展示自己才华的机会。

    以下是关于全国性编程比赛的一些重要信息:

    1. 参赛对象:全国性编程比赛通常面向不同年龄段的参赛者,包括学生和职业程序员。不同比赛可能有不同的参赛要求和分组。

    2. 比赛形式:全国性编程比赛的形式多种多样。常见的比赛形式包括个人赛、团队赛和在线赛。个人赛是指每个参赛者单独完成编程任务;团队赛是指参赛者组成团队,共同解决编程问题;在线赛则是通过互联网进行远程比赛。

    3. 比赛内容:全国性编程比赛的内容通常包括算法设计、数据结构、编程语言和软件开发等方面的知识和技能。参赛者需要在限定时间内完成一系列编程任务,根据任务要求编写代码并提交结果。

    4. 比赛评判:比赛的评判通常由专业的评委团队进行。评委会根据参赛者的代码质量、程序执行效率、正确性和创新性等方面进行评分。同时,参赛者之间也可以互相交流和学习,通过比赛来提高自己的编程水平。

    5. 奖项和机会:全国性编程比赛通常设有丰厚的奖项和机会。优秀的参赛者有机会获得奖金、奖品、荣誉证书和学术或职业发展机会。此外,比赛也为参赛者提供了与其他编程爱好者交流、学习和展示自己的平台,有助于建立个人声誉和拓展人脉。

    总之,全国性编程比赛是一种促进编程技能提升和交流的活动,对于参赛者来说是一次锻炼和展示自己才华的机会。参加这类比赛可以提高编程能力、培养团队合作精神,并有机会获得奖励和发展机会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    全国性编程比赛是一种面向全国范围内的编程竞赛活动。它旨在通过竞赛的形式来促进编程技能的提升和交流,激发参赛选手的创新思维和解决问题的能力。全国性编程比赛通常由相关的教育机构、科研机构或企业组织和举办,参赛选手来自全国各地的高校、研究机构、企事业单位等。

    下面将从方法、操作流程等方面详细介绍全国性编程比赛的内容和意义。

    一、方法

    1. 题目设计:全国性编程比赛的题目设计一般会涉及多个领域的知识和技能,包括算法、数据结构、网络编程、人工智能等。题目难度也会根据比赛的级别和参赛选手的水平来确定,既有基础题目,也有高难度的挑战题目。

    2. 编程语言:参赛选手可以使用自己熟悉的编程语言进行编程。常见的编程语言包括C、C++、Java、Python等。不同的编程语言有不同的特点和优势,选手可以根据自己的喜好和熟练程度选择合适的语言。

    3. 编程环境:为了保证比赛的公平性和一致性,全国性编程比赛一般会提供统一的编程环境,包括编译器、编辑器、调试器等。选手在比赛期间使用相同的环境,以确保比赛的公正性。

    4. 时间限制:全国性编程比赛一般会规定参赛选手在限定的时间内完成题目的解答。时间限制既是对选手解决问题能力的考验,也是对选手时间管理和应变能力的挑战。

    二、操作流程

    1. 报名注册:参赛选手需要提前在比赛官方网站或平台进行报名注册。报名时需要填写个人信息和联系方式,并支付相应的报名费用(如果有)。一般比赛会规定报名截止日期,过期后将无法进行报名。

    2. 赛前准备:在比赛开始前,选手可以提前了解比赛的规则和要求,熟悉比赛的操作流程和编程环境。选手还可以通过参加模拟赛或练习题来熟悉比赛的题目类型和解题技巧。

    3. 比赛进行:比赛开始后,选手可以登录比赛平台,查看和下载比赛题目。选手需要根据题目要求,分析问题,设计算法,编写代码并进行调试,最终得到正确的解答。在比赛过程中,选手需要合理分配时间和精力,尽可能高效地解决问题。

    4. 提交答案:在比赛规定的时间内,选手需要将自己的解答提交到比赛平台。通常,比赛平台会提供相应的提交通道,选手可以将自己的代码上传到平台上进行评测。评测结果会实时显示,选手可以根据评测结果进行调试和修改。

    5. 比赛结束与评奖:比赛结束后,组织方会对选手的答案进行评测和排名。评奖结果通常包括个人奖项和团体奖项,获奖选手将获得相应的证书、奖金或奖品。

    三、意义

    1. 提升编程技能:全国性编程比赛为参赛选手提供了一个锻炼编程能力的平台。通过参加比赛,选手可以接触到各种类型的编程题目,提高算法设计和问题解决的能力,掌握更多的编程技巧和方法。

    2. 交流学习机会:全国性编程比赛汇聚了来自全国各地的优秀选手,参赛选手可以与其他选手进行交流和学习。通过与他人的交流和合作,可以拓宽自己的视野,学习到更多的编程思想和技术。

    3. 增强竞争力:参加全国性编程比赛可以提高个人的竞争力。在比赛中获得好的成绩或者获奖,可以为个人的求职或升学提供有力的证明和参考。同时,比赛也可以锻炼选手的心理素质和应变能力,增强自信心。

    4. 激发创新思维:全国性编程比赛通常设置一些高难度的挑战题目,要求选手有创新思维和解决复杂问题的能力。通过参加比赛,选手可以锻炼自己的创新思维,培养解决问题的能力。

    总之,全国性编程比赛是一种促进编程技能提升和交流学习的重要活动。通过参加比赛,选手可以提高自己的编程能力,拓宽视野,增强竞争力,并且获得一些实际的奖励和认可。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部